南大通用GBase 8a提供了show datacopymap功能来查询指定的表,在所有的计算节点上是否有不可用的情况,比如节点离线或服务不可用,某些分片有dmlevent,ddlevent,dmlstorageevent等情况。分片状态正常为0,如果不是0,则表示该主机的该分片,当前不可用,22表示服务离线,包括主机离线;16表示有ddlevent, 2表示有dmlevent。总之,只要不是0,后续的访问就不该继续使用该分片。
分类: GBase8a日常使用
类似使用手册,普通的各种功能的使用方法,SQL语法,函数的功能介绍,各种工具的常规使用等。一些疑难杂症归类到常见疑问里。
南大通用GBase 8a 自定义存储过程 sp_cluster_processlist 查看集群任务SQL状态
南大通用GBase 8a提供了show processlist命令查看本机的SQL运行状态,也提供了COORDINATORS_TASK_INFORMATION元数据表来查看集群所有调度节点的SQL运行状态。本文提供一个自定义存储过程,来简化运维人员的使用难度。
南大通用GBase 8a 自定义存储过程查看表分片数据量、行数
南大通用GBase 8a提供了查看分布表各分片数据量的功能,在新版9.5里又提供了segment_id来查看分片分片数据,本文提供了2个自定义存储过程,来方便试用。
南大通用GBase 8a 支持Base64加解密函数V9.5.3版本
从GBase 8a V9.5.3版本开始,内置支持Base64的加密和解密,通过to_base64和from_base64两个函数实现。
南大通用GBase 8a一个CUDF样例
本文提供一个简单的GBase 8a数据库集群,采用C编写UDF的样例代码,仅供参考。
南大通用GBase 8a安装时修改指定默认的端口方法
南大通用GBase 8a数据库集群,默认使用一些端口号,比如5258,5050等,但支持用户在安装时,修改端口号,用指定的端口安装数据库集群。本文介绍GBase 8a安装时修改指定默认的端口方法。
南大通用GBase 8a 排序支持nulls first / last的使用样例,包括开窗函数
在GBase 8a 8.6.2Build43版本,开始支持在开窗函数和普通排序order 部分指定null值的位置,包括 nulls first, 和 nulls last,不之指定时默认是nulls last效果。
南大通用GBase 8a 对明文密码的安全保护措施
本文介绍在GBase 8a 数据库集群里,在涉及密码明文的安全保护方面处理措施,确保密码明文不会被获得。包括命令行登录密码,SQL语句里连接数据源的密码,同时在数据库日志里也需要屏蔽。
南大通用GBase 8a V8版本节点替换期间通过并发数控制资源使用减少对系统影响的方法
在节点替换期间,需要从备份节点读取并传输大量数据,必然会对现有系统造成影响。在V9版本里是通过重分布的方式实现… 继续阅读 南大通用GBase 8a V8版本节点替换期间通过并发数控制资源使用减少对系统影响的方法
南大通用GBase 8a 从集群层通过segment_id直接查询分片数据排查倾斜
南大通用GBase 8a 数据库集群,将数据按照用户指定的分布格式切分,保存在多台数据计算节点上。本文介绍在新版9.5.3版本里,如果通过segment_id直接查询某些计算节点的数据。